Fitch Ratings has raised its forecast for global GDP growth in 2023 to 2.4%, from 2% in its March forecast, but lowered the forecast for 2024 growth to 2.1% from 2.4%, due to longer lags in the impact of higher interest rates, along with weaker base effects for EM growth. 

It raised China’s 2023 forecast to 5.6% from 5.2% after a swifter-than-expected reopening rebound in the first quarter, saying that although the recovery has faltered somewhat in recent months, consumption continues to normalise and macro policy is starting to be eased. 

The agency revised up EM ex-China growth for 2023 to 2.9% from 2.0% with Brazil, India, Mexico and Russia seeing substantive improvements, it said. It raised the forecast for US growth in 2023 to 1.2% from 1% as consumption and job growth remain robust and said it still expects the US Federal Reserve tightening to push the economy into a mild recession, but the timing of this has been pushed out to 4Q23-1Q24.
